Restaurants nearby 61A Lancaster Road, London W11 1QG, United Kingdom



202 London

Approximately 0.53 km away
Address: 202 Westbourne Grove, Notting Hill, London W11 2SB

202

Approximately 0.53 km away
Address: 202 Westbourne Grove, London W11 2RH, UK

The Metropolitan

Approximately 0.54 km away
Address: 60 Great Western Road, Notting Hill, London W11 1AB

Walmer Castle

Approximately 0.55 km away
Address: 58 Ledbury Road, Notting Hill, London W11 2AJ

Anar Persian Kitchen

Approximately 0.56 km away
Address: 349 Portobello Road, Ladbroke Grove, London W10 5SA

The Portobello Gold

Approximately 0.56 km away
Address: 95-97 Portobello Road, Notting Hill, London W11 2QB

Ottolenghi

Approximately 0.56 km away
Address: 63 Ledbury Rd, Notting Hill, London W11 2AD, UK

Portobello Gold

Approximately 0.58 km away
Address: 95-97 Portobello Road, London W11 2QB, United Kingdom

Maramia Cafe

Approximately 0.58 km away
Address: 48 Golborne Road, Ladbroke Grove, London W10 5PR

Maramia Cafe

Approximately 0.58 km away
Address: 48 Golborne Road, London W10 5PR, United Kingdom

Palki

Approximately 0.59 km away
Address: 44 Golborne Road, Ladbroke Grove, London W10 5PR

Palki Indian Restaurant

Approximately 0.59 km away
Address: 44 Golborne Road, London W10 5PR, United Kingdom

John Doe

Approximately 0.59 km away
Address: 46 Golborne Road, Ladbroke Grove, London W10 5PR

The Oak

Approximately 0.62 km away
Address: 137 Westbourne Park Road, Notting Hill, London W2 5QL

Casa Cruz

Approximately 0.63 km away
Address: 123 Clarendon Road, Holland Park, London W11 4JG